WebSep 19, 2024 · Proof of case 1. Assume A is not invertible . Then: det (A) = 0. Also if A is not invertible then neither is AB . Indeed, if AB has an inverse C, then: ABC = I. whereby BC is a right inverse of A . It follows by Left or Right Inverse of Matrix is Inverse that in that case BC is the inverse of A . Web7. The determinant of a triangular matrix is the product of the diagonal entries (pivots) d1, d2, ..., dn. Property 5 tells us that the determinant of the triangular matrix won’t change if we use elimination to convert it to a diagonal matrix with the entries di on its diagonal. WebDec 2, 2024 · 5. Sum Determinant Property. If each term of any row or any column is a sum of two quantities, then the determinant can be expressed as the sum of the two determinants of the same order. This is called the sum property.
